Output 3414c6c8a16e10626852e09a44c745b6262afede65a12ead2cf022238287346f:6

value
840959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46f328b339c2886c8c800894220f6f0e6e196222 OP_EQUAL
address
38AAWxJdcBkfMoAbJnDP2vMiRfUkXgDNzL
transaction
3414c6c8a16e10626852e09a44c745b6262afede65a12ead2cf022238287346f
confirmations
444941
spent
true